国产Excel开发组件Spire.XLS【转换】教程(8):如何在 C#、VB.NET 中将 Excel 转换为文本

本文旨在介绍一种简单的解决方案,通过名为 Spire.Xls 的强大且独立的 Excel .NET 组件将 Excel (xls/xlsx) 转换为 C# 和 VB.NET 中的文本

本文旨在介绍一种简单的解决方案,通过名为 Spire.Xls 的强大且独立的 Excel .NET 组件将 Excel (xls/xlsx) 转换为 C# 和 VB.NET 中的文本。同时,此Excel API支持将 Excel (xls/xlsx) 转换为 PDF、HTML、Image、CSV、XML等,无需在机器上安装 Microsoft Excel。从这里下载试试看。

第 1 步:创建 Spire.Xls.Document 的实例。

Workbook workbook = new Workbook();

第 2 步:根据指定的文件名加载文件。

workbook.LoadFromFile(@"..ExceltoTxt.xls");

第 3 步:获取 Worksheet 的第一个工作表。

<font style="vertical-align: inherit;"><font style="vertical-align: inherit;">工作表工作表 = workbook.Worksheets[0];</font></font>

第 4 步:将文档对象保存到 Txt 文件。

</font></font>

效果截图

Excel_to_Txt
<font style="vertical-align: inherit;"><font style="vertical-align: inherit;">sheet.SaveToFile("ExceltoTxt.txt", " ", Encoding.UTF8);</font></font>

Excel_to_Txt

示例代码

[C#]

using Spire.Xls;namespace Excel_to_Txt{class Program{static void Main(string[] args){Workbook workbook = new Workbook();workbook.LoadFromFile(@"..ExceltoTxt.xls");Worksheet sheet = workbook.Worksheets[0];sheet.SaveToFile("ExceltoTxt.txt", " ", Encoding.UTF8);}}}

[VB.NET]

Imports Spire.XlsNamespace Excel_to_TxtFriend Class ProgramShared Sub Main(ByVal args() As String)Dim workbook As New Workbook()workbook.LoadFromFile("..ExceltoTxt.xls ")Dim sheet As Worksheet = workbook.Worksheets(0)sheet.SaveToFile("ExceltoTxt.txt", " ", Encoding.UTF8)End SubEnd ClassEnd Namespace


欢迎下载|体验更多E-iceblue产品

获取更多信息请咨询在线客服  或加入Q群


标签:

来源:慧都

声明:本站部分文章及图片转载于互联网,内容版权归原作者所有,如本站任何资料有侵权请您尽早请联系jinwei@zod.com.cn进行处理,非常感谢!

上一篇 2022年4月27日
下一篇 2022年4月27日

相关推荐

发表回复

登录后才能评论